Abstract

Un procedimiento para preparar polimerizados, que son apropiados para absorber y almacenar líquidos acuosos, así como los polimerizados que se obtienen de acuerdo con este procedimiento. También, uso de estos polimerizados. El procedimiento comprende las siguientes etapas: polimerización radicálica reticulante de una composición monomérica M, que comprende a) al menos un monómero A, que presenta un enlace doble etilénico y al menos un grupo ácido neutralizable o un grupo hidrolizable en un grupo ácido neutralizable, b) eventualmente uno o varios comonómeros B distintos de los monómeros A, que presentan un enlace doble etilénico, y c) 0,05 al 10% en peso, referido a la cantidad total de los monómeros A y B, al menos de un reticulante C en presencia de al menos una sustancia S que contiene un polisacárido, en un líquido acuoso en donde la relación en peso de la composición monomérica M a la sustancia S está en el rango de 9: 1 a 1: 9; y al menos neutralización parcial de los grupos ácidos y/o hidrólisis de los grupos hidrolizables en grupos ácidos neutralizables en el polimerizado obtenido en la etapa i.; en donde se lleva a cabo la polimerización y/o la neutralización en presencia de urea.
